Checklist — Bulk edits, Grovetable admin. Plugin authors: bulk actions now batch in groups of 200; hooks fire once per batch, not per row. Update `onRowsChanged` handlers accordingly. Old per-row behavior removed, no shim. Test against the sandbox tier before release. The compatible platform build is listed below.

build token for tawip-yageg: htk9_92ac43d42

MEMO — Launch Plan: Glimmerpath 2.0

To the finance team: Vandris Labs will launch Glimmerpath 2.0 in the autumn window. Budget allocations cover tooling, a modest media spend, and channel incentives for the Ostermere region. Pricing is locked; invoicing templates need updating before general availability. Expect a revenue recognition briefing from Controller Ines Farrow ahead of launch week. No headcount changes are planned. For context, the confidential summary of our broader commercial plans follows below.

management briefing: Jorixax Holdings is in early talks to buy Casixax Holdings for about $420.3 million. The Fenmir launch date is October 27, and nothing goes to the press before then. Legal wants the Keloxek Foods term sheet redrafted before April 16.

Team — quick note on Ledgerbee blue-green deploys. The billing worker always runs two pools; traffic flips only after the smoke suite passes on green. Never patch blue in place. Rollback is one command in the deploy console, no approvals needed during an incident. Before flipping, confirm green is running the build identified by the token below.

trace token, bawef-hagug: htk14_86959b54a07f99

**Ticket #4471 — ChipTrack reader misconfigured at Larkspur Marathon** The finish-line reader at the Larkspur event is polling the staging ingest endpoint instead of production, so split times aren't syncing. Root cause: the env file on the reader cart was copied from the test rig and is missing the production credential. Fix is to add the following line to the reader's env file:

env line for fafof-fahag: LEDGER_TOKEN5=f8790